FACULTY ANNOUNCEMENT

In 1989 Valerie Rixon joined the Havergal Community teaching Grade 1, and since then she has forever enriched the lives of countless young girls on their journey through the Junior School. It is with a heavy heart that I announce she is leaving in January, 2017 to spend time with her family in England in her retirement.

Valerie is a consummate and professional educator with a resume too long, too dynamic and too full to list in detail here. Beyond her dedication to her students in the classroom, she has led numerous popular co-curricular activities focusing on the arts, academics and she even bravely tackled coaching Track and Field last year! One of the biggest legacies that she will leave behind is Philosophy For Children (P4C). This approach to learning encourages students to create philosophical questions to promote inquiry, dialogue and reflection. As the students have grasped this approach and expanded the depth of their learning, so have we all - her colleagues and dear friends.

We are so very grateful for her many contributions to Havergal College and thankful for the impact she will leave on all of us, most importantly - her students. We look forward to celebrating her distinguished career and accomplishments at a later date to be advised.

Please join me in congratulating her and wishing her well.

REMEMBRANCE DAY IN THE JUNIOR SCHOOL
The Junior School will recognize Remembrance Day on Monday, November 7 at 9:30 am. As always, we encourage all family members to join us at this special service. Please note that the Junior School Grandpals' Day will take place on Friday, May 12 at 10:30 am this year.

We ask that your daughter come to school in her #1 uniform. The Royal Canadian Legion, Fairbanks Branch #75 has provided us with poppies and poppy stickers for every girl in the Junior School to wear at the service. Please help us to help them by sending in a donation of a loonie or toonie to show our appreciation. The Poppy Campaign is one of the Legion's most important programs. The money raised from donations provides direct assistance for Veterans in financial distress, as well as funding for medical appliances and research, home services, care facilities and numerous other valuable and needed services.
